1

Keep Your Car's Paint Through PPF Installation Near You!

nannietewk414483
Want to protect your vehicle's coating from the elements? Professional-grade paint protection film (PPF) is the best option. It gives a clear barrier against scratches, abrasions, and UV rays. A PPF installation https://sites.google.com/view/mk-auto-design-tulsa-ok/home
Report this page

Comments

    HTML is allowed

Who Upvoted this Story